Spring is the perfect time to refresh your beauty routine and embrace a fresh, natural look. Instead of spending a fortune on expensive beauty products, why not try some DIY beauty tips? Not only are they cost-effective, but they also allow you to customize your skincare and makeup routine to suit your needs.

Here are 10 DIY beauty tips for spring:

  1. Exfoliate with a DIY sugar scrub: Mix together some sugar and olive oil to create a gentle exfoliating scrub for your face and body. This will help remove dead skin cells and leave your skin feeling smooth and refreshed.
  2. Create your own face mask: Mix together ingredients like honey, yogurt, and avocado to create a nourishing face mask. Apply it to your skin and leave it on for 15-20 minutes before rinsing off for a glowing complexion.
  3. Make a natural lip scrub: Mix together some honey and brown sugar to create a homemade lip scrub. Gently massage it onto your lips to remove dry, flaky skin and reveal softer, smoother lips.
  4. Hydrate your skin with a DIY facial mist: Fill a spray bottle with rose water or green tea and mist it onto your face throughout the day to keep your skin hydrated and refreshed.
  5. Use coconut oil as a moisturizer: Coconut oil is a natural and deeply nourishing moisturizer. Apply a small amount to your face and body to keep your skin moisturized and glowing.
  6. Create your own natural hair mask: Mix together ingredients like coconut oil, honey, and avocado to create a homemade hair mask. Apply it to your hair, leave it on for 30 minutes, and then rinse off for shiny, healthy-looking locks.
  7. Make your own body scrub: Mix together ingredients like coffee grounds, coconut oil, and brown sugar to create a homemade body scrub. Use it in the shower to exfoliate your skin and leave it feeling smooth and rejuvenated.
  8. DIY natural makeup remover: Mix together equal parts of olive oil and witch hazel to create a gentle and effective makeup remover. Apply it to a cotton pad and use it to remove your makeup at the end of the day.
  9. Create your own tinted lip balm: Melt together some beeswax, coconut oil, and your favorite lipstick or lip stain to create a customized tinted lip balm. This will add a pop of color to your lips while keeping them moisturized.
  10. Use a DIY face mist: Mix together some distilled water, aloe vera gel, and a few drops of your favorite essential oil to create a refreshing face mist. Spritz it onto your face throughout the day to keep your skin hydrated and give it a healthy glow.

These DIY beauty tips are easy to make and use, and they can help you achieve a natural, radiant look this spring. Give them a try and see the difference they can make in your beauty routine.
